For this year's International Missions Emphasis, we are thinking outside the box - literally.

The kit is gone. Pastors, old and new, may remember receiving a box each year in preparation for the Lottie Moon Christmas Offering, Week of Prayer and International Mission Study. The box contained an issue of theCOMMISSION magazine, a video, fliers, missions facts, a resource catalog and the annual report. But the random elements left many churches wondering, "What do we do with this?"

In its place, a planning guide chock-full of resources: It's just as colorful and exciting as the kit of past years but more user friendly and practical. Inside you'll find almost everything but the kitchen sink:
· a planning calendar
· suggestions from other churches on how to promote the Lottie Moon Christmas Offering
· compelling stories that can be retold from the pulpit
· a CD with video and PowerPoint resources
· clip art
· strategies for involving numerous church ministries

Additional items you can order: You also will find a resource section that lists posters, videos, maps and books that can enhance your International Missions Emphasis.

How-tos: And you will find tips and insights as to how you can best use the products and services available to you. It's everything you need-except the kitchen sink.

Available: Churches should receive their guides by Oct. 1.
